Compare Pleasant Grove to Kearns

This post compares Pleasant Grove, Utah to Kearns, Utah across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Pleasant Grove (city) Kearns (CDP)
Population 37,439 37,194
Income (median) $47,327 $35,322
Home Value (median) $251,400 $164,900
White 93% 70%
Black 0% 1%
Asian 1% 3%
With Kids 49% 52%
Age (median) 25 29
Rentals 33% 18%
